National Tree Day Brings the Community Together at Currawong Park
On Sunday morning, the volunteers of Currawong Park teamed up with Co-exist Tamworth to celebrate National Tree Day with a fantastic morning
of planting, community connection and a delicious BBQ.
Together, volunteers planted 40 new trees and plants, helping to expand and enhance the existing garden bed at Currawong Park a Landcare Initiative. The morning was a wonderful opportunity for the community to come together, get their hands dirty and contribute to creating a greener, healthier space for everyone to enjoy.
The planting also provided a chance to learn more about the native plants growing throughout the garden, including enjoying a unique taste of old man saltbush that was already growing at the site – even making its way into the sausages cooked on the BBQ!
A big thank you goes to all the wonderful volunteers who came along and helped make the morning such a success. Events like these highlight the importance of community involvement in caring for our local environment and demonstrate what can be achieved when passionate groups work together.
We look forward to watching the new plants grow and seeing the garden continue to thrive for years to come!
